Beautifully renovated home - A truly superb, professionally renovated three-bedroom semi-detached home, situated in this ever-popular, mature location in the sought-after village of Sawley. The property occupies a generous plot and has been upgraded with stylish contemporary fittings and tasteful neutral décor throughout. It would be ideally suited to a first-time buyer or a young family.

The property benefits from gas central heating via a combination boiler and uPVC double glazing. In brief, the accommodation comprises an entrance hallway, a lounge, and a superb dining kitchen with French doors leading to the rear garden, along with a separate utility room and WC.

Upstairs, the first-floor landing provides access to a particularly spacious primary bedroom, a second bedroom, and a contemporary shower room.

Externally, the property offers a generous driveway and a detached garage. To the rear, there is a good-sized enclosed garden with a patio and potential lawn area.

The Location

Nestled between the River Trent and the Erewash Canal, Sawley offers a highly desirable blend of semi-rural tranquillity and excellent connectivity. This property is ideally positioned to enjoy both the charm of village life and the wide range of amenities available in Long Eaton.

The area is well placed for convenient access to the M1 (J24 and J25) and the A50, making it ideal for commuters. Long Eaton railway station is just a short distance away, providing direct services to Nottingham, Derby and London St Pancras. East Midlands Airport is also within easy reach, approximately a 15-minute drive away.

A selection of independent shops, traditional pubs and cafés are all within walking distance, adding to the appeal of village life. For leisure, there is immediate access to Sawley Marina and scenic canal-side walks, perfect for weekends. The bustling town centre of Long Eaton is only minutes away, offering major supermarkets, including Tesco Extra and Asda, along with a wider range of retail options.

The property is situated within the catchment area for well-regarded local primary schools, making it an excellent choice for families.
